Luke Bryan Expands ‘Farm Tour’ with Fall Dates

Luke Bryan has unveiled new fall dates for his “Farm Tour,” with shows scheduled across three Midwest locations from September 18 to 20. 

The tour is set to kick off with previously announced dates on May 15 in Atwater, California at The Castle Airport. From there, Bryan will make stops in Clovis California on May 15 before his last Farm Tour stop on May 17 in Shafter, California at Sillect Farms.

The newly announced stops include Brooklyn, Wisconsin, Prairie Grove, Illinois, and Lansing, Michigan. Tickets for these shows will be available to the general public beginning Thursday, April 11, at 8:00 a.m. CT.

Following his “Farm Tour” dates, the country singer is also gearing up for his “Country Song Came On” tour. The tour is slated to kick off on May 29 in Bethel, NY, at the Bethel Woods Center for the Arts. From there, the country singer is scheduled to make stops in cities such as Syracuse, Raleigh, Savannah, Dallas, Toronto, Charleston, Cincinnati, and Hartford before wrapping up on August 30 in Buffalo at Darien Lake Amphitheater.

In addition to the tour dates, Bryan is also scheduled to perform at a number of festivals. The “Country Girl” singer is set to take the stage at CMA Music Fest as well as Country Jam Colorado and Ocean City’s Country Calling among others.
